AVT Sentinel™ uses a combination of GSM/GPRS mobile phone technology and GPS satellite technology to locate your vehicle with an accuracy of around 5 metres in the event of it being stolen. Unlike other systems that rely on an expensive ongoing payment for monitoring services, Sentinel™ uses the Vodafone network to send a text with your vehicle's current position directly to your mobile phone.

As well as being able to inform the police of your vehicle's position when reporting it stolen, you can also enable Sentinel™ to allow your vehicle's position to be seen on a web browser simply by entering it's registration number and a password. If the police controller wants to use this facility via their existing internet access, it is there.

Being able to tell the police the exact location of your vehicle gives them the opportunity to apprehend the thieves if they are still with the vehicle, or to make sure that the vehicle is secure and not a hazard to other traffic if already abandoned. The police know that a stolen vehicle is often driven badly or at excessive speed and is a hazard to other road users, but attempting to find most stolen vehicles is like looking for a needle in a haystack and can become a low priority. With Sentinel tracking the vehicle, they can know exactly where the vehicle is on a second-by-second basis and therefore it is practical for a patrol car in the area to be directed to intercept it. Not only does this remove potentially dangerous drivers from the road, but they might also arrest the thief which can only help improve 'clear-up rates'.

AVT Sentinel™ uses the Vodafone network, giving superb coverage thoughout the UK and Europe, and operates with an inbuilt PAYT (pay as you talk) SIM card avoiding monthly subscription costs. (Your own phone can be connected to any network. It doesn't have to be with Vodafone.) By using the latest generation of mobile phone and GPS receiver modules from Siemens, Sentinel™ is extremely sensitive and can obtain an accurate position in areas where a normal handheld GPS or Satnav unit will struggle.

You don't even need to discover your vehicle is missing - it can tell you! If your vehicle is moved without being started, or moves outside of a 'fenced area' even if started with the key, you are sent a text message and the unit starts tracking. The 'fenced area' can be set or reset as required with a simple text message - ideal for airport car parks, for example.

Other than the initial purchase price, if Sentinel is quietly protecting your vehicle, then the ongoing costs are less than £4 per year, these being the cost of an occasional message to the AVT servers to keep the SIM card active and to tell you that the unit is working. Even if your vehicle is stolen and the unit is activated, the costs only amount to about 30p per hour of tracking. A full list of text and data costs are shown here.
